As soon as a design is ended up, the board enters pcb fabrication. This is the manufacturing process that produces the bare printed motherboard before components are included. Pcb fabrication manufacturers and pcb manufacturers form the board from materials such as FR4, Rogers laminates, polyimide, aluminum, ceramic pcb materials, or metal core pcb material depending on the application. FR4 prevails since it is economical, secure, and extensively readily available, yet high frequency pcb and hdi pcb styles may call for customized materials with controlled dielectric properties. During pcb fabrication, layers of copper are laminated to insulating material, openings are pierced or lasered, vias are produced, and surfaces are completed with choices such as HASL or ENIG. When people ask "how are circuit boards made" or "what are pcb boards made from," the solution is a split mix of protecting substrate, copper traces, and protective surface finishes.
Pcb assembly is the following major step, where components are mounted onto the made board. In functional terms, pcba vs pcb is simple: the pcb is the bare board, while the pcba is the finished board with components mounted. Modern boards count on numerous interconnect technologies, consisting of pcb via, microvia, blind via, buried via, and blind and buried vias. These features make it feasible to path signals between layers in multilayer pcb structures. High density interconnect, or hdi pcb, is especially important in compact devices where space is limited and routing intricacy is high. HDI printed motherboard frequently use microvias and fine lines to support thick component layouts such as bga pcb assembly. When designers ask regarding what is a via, the response is that it is a plated hole that attaches electrical layers in the board. There are numerous kinds of circuit card constructions. Rigid pcb is the standard format used in most devices, while flexible pcb, flex pcb, flexible printed motherboard, and flex circuits permit the board to bend or fold. Flexible motherboard manufacturers and flex circuit manufacturers create these boards for wearable devices, video cameras, medical tools, and portable electronics. Rigid flex pcb and rigid flex circuit styles combine rigid and flexible areas right into one assembly, which saves space and boosts reliability in systems that require movement or intricate type factors. Flexible printed circuits and flex circuit card items are useful in applications where repeated activity is required. The components placed on a board vary commonly depending upon the application. Electronic components pcb assemblies might consist of resistors, capacitors, inductors, integrated circuits, connectors, power components, sensors, and semiconductors. People commonly ask what semiconductors are used for or what are semiconductors used in, and the solution is that they are the energetic devices at the heart of virtually all contemporary electronics, regulating current and making it possible for boosting, processing, and changing. Capacitors also show up everywhere on a motherboard, and sorts of capacitors include ceramic, electrolytic, film, tantalum, and much more specific selections. Capacitors circuit functions include filtering system, decoupling, timing, energy storage space, and signal combining.
